La versione in lingua italiana fornita proviene da una traduzione automatica. Per eventuali incoerenze, fare riferimento alla versione in lingua inglese.
Ottenere le informazioni di controllo per un file
Collaboratori
È possibile recuperare le informazioni di controllo per un file o una cartella specifici.
Metodo HTTP ed endpoint
Questa chiamata API REST utilizza il metodo e l'endpoint seguenti.
Metodo HTTP | Percorso |
---|---|
OTTIENI |
/api/protocolli/file-security/permissions/{svm.uuid}/{path} |
Tipo di elaborazione
Sincrono
Parametri di input aggiuntivi per esempi di arricciatura
Oltre ai parametri comuni a tutte le chiamate REST API, nell'esempio curl in questo passo vengono utilizzati anche i seguenti parametri.
Parametro | Tipo | Obbligatorio | Descrizione |
---|---|---|---|
$SVM_ID |
Percorso |
Sì |
UUUID della SVM che contiene il file. |
$PERCORSO_FILE |
Percorso |
Sì |
Questo è il percorso del file o della cartella. |
Esempio di arricciamento
curl --request GET \
--location "https://$FQDN_IP/api/protocols/file-security/permissions/$SVM_ID/$FILE_PATH" \
--include \
--header "Accept: */*" \
--header "Authorization: Basic $BASIC_AUTH"
Esempio di output JSON
{ "svm": { "uuid": "9479099d-5b9f-11eb-9c4e-0050568e8682", "name": "vs1" }, "path": "/parent", "owner": "BUILTIN\\Administrators", "group": "BUILTIN\\Administrators", "control_flags": "0x8014", "acls": [ { "user": "BUILTIN\\Administrators", "access": "access_allow", "apply_to": { "files": true, "sub_folders": true, "this_folder": true }, "advanced_rights": { "append_data": true, "delete": true, "delete_child": true, "execute_file": true, "full_control": true, "read_attr": true, "read_data": true, "read_ea": true, "read_perm": true, "write_attr": true, "write_data": true, "write_ea": true, "write_owner": true, "synchronize": true, "write_perm": true }, "access_control": "file_directory" }, { "user": "BUILTIN\\Users", "access": "access_allow", "apply_to": { "files": true, "sub_folders": true, "this_folder": true }, "advanced_rights": { "append_data": true, "delete": true, "delete_child": true, "execute_file": true, "full_control": true, "read_attr": true, "read_data": true, "read_ea": true, "read_perm": true, "write_attr": true, "write_data": true, "write_ea": true, "write_owner": true, "synchronize": true, "write_perm": true }, "access_control": "file_directory" } ], "inode": 64, "security_style": "mixed", "effective_style": "ntfs", "dos_attributes": "10", "text_dos_attr": "----D---", "user_id": "0", "group_id": "0", "mode_bits": 777, "text_mode_bits": "rwxrwxrwx" }